Scope and content
A collection of original notes sent to Éamon de Valera and Patrick Pearse during the 1916 Rising. At least two of the notes appear to have been written by Commandant Thomas Cornelius Hunter (1883-1932) who served as an adjutant in the 2nd Battalion of the Irish Volunteers during the Rising. The notes appear to relate to orders emanating from and given to the Jacob’s factory garrison during the insurrection. Reference is also made in the notes to another senior Volunteer, Adjunct Thomas Slater. The notes were extant with a cover letter from Tomás S. Cuffe to Fr. Senan Moynihan OFM Cap. apparently referring to his retrieval of 1916 material (4 December 1947).
